This Stipulation to Extend Time (NY) is a standard form that attorneys can use to extend most deadlines in a civil action in New York Supreme Court. The stipulation extends the applicable deadline on consent without prior permission from the court.

A summons with notice or summons and complaint must be served within 120 days of filing with the County Clerk.

Substituted Service (CPLR 308(2)): If service is made by leaving the summons at the defendant's dwelling or usual place of abode with a person of suitable age and discretion, and then mailed, the defendant has 20 days from the date the affidavit of service is filed to answer.

A summons with notice is a type of summons. The summons with notice is not served with the complaint. It contains all of the information described above for the summons, plus a brief description of the type of case and the relief the plaintiff is asking the court to grant.
